Output 152983211a98da373f8c894781873867bacbf94fef881d2c6d34a0cc7dba07fc:0

value
108853
script pubkey
OP_0 OP_PUSHBYTES_20 3985aec8c1c250a94fbd9b120ad515482872f90a
address
bc1q8xz6ajxpcfg2jnaanvfq44g4fq5897g2gnnp3c
transaction
152983211a98da373f8c894781873867bacbf94fef881d2c6d34a0cc7dba07fc
confirmations
1993
spent
true